尖端神手Ansible 究极自动化组态管理工具

尖端神手Ansible 究极自动化组态管理工具 pdf epub mobi txt 电子书 下载 2025

图书标签:
  • Ansible
  • 自动化
  • 配置管理
  • DevOps
  • 运维
  • Linux
  • Python
  • IT
  • 系统管理
  • 基础设施即代码
想要找书就要到 小特书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

Ansible是对机群进行软体安装、设定和应用部署的自动化工具。

  本书涵盖Ansible中的精华,侧重于实战,全书程式码均实测过,是一本不可多得的Ansible入门书。

  本书以新的自动化运维工具Ansible为主要内容,侧重于实战,由浅入深地介绍Ansible以及周边产品Ansible Galaxy和Ansible Tower的用法。

  全书共计6章,前4章由浅及深、层层递进地介绍Ansible的使用方法。第5章着重介绍Ansible的代码分享机制role以及其分享平台Ansible Galaxy。第6章概括性地介绍企业级软体Ansible Tower。

  全书的叙述风格通俗易懂,没有过多地引入复杂的概念,侧重于讲解原理,立足于实战,引领Ansible新手轻松入门。

本书特色

  裸机主机/虚拟化系统/云端环境
  Python开发/开放原始码软体供应/配置管理/应用程序部署
  轻量/架构灵活/安全可靠/一致性环境/高效运行维护
  Ansible学习成本小、学习路径短,本书涵盖Ansible精华是绝佳的入门书
 

著者信息

作者简介

史晶晶


  资深软体工程师,目前在Red Hat从事Linux与云端平台的工具开发工作。
 

图书目录

前言
01 Ansible 介绍
1.1 Ansible 介绍
1.2 Ansible 解决了什么运行维护痛点
1.3 架构

02 Ansible 入门
2.1 安装Ansible
2.2 Ansible 管理哪些主机
2.3 Ansible 用指令管理主机
2.4 Ansible 用指令稿管理主机
2.5 Ansible 模组

03 Ansible 进阶
3.1 Ansible 的设定
3.2 主机清单
3.3 Ansible 的指令稿Playbook
3.4 更多的Ansible 模组
3.5 最佳使用方法

04 Ansible Playbook 杂谈
4.1 再谈Ansible 变数
4.2 使用lookup 存取外部档案或资料库中的资料
4.3 筛检程式
4.4 测试变数或运算式是否符合条件
4.5 认识外挂程式

05 role 和Ansible Galaxy
5.1 role 和Ansible Galaxy 的简介
5.2 role 的放置位置
5.3 在Playbook 中如何唿叫role
5.4 如何写role
5.5 role 的依赖
5.6 Ansible Galaxy 网站介绍
5.7 示范role 的建立和分享

06 Ansible Tower
6.1 为什么要用Ansible Tower
6.2 如何使用Ansible Tower
6.3 与协力厂商平台的整合

A 参考资料

图书序言

前言

  ✤ 内容介绍

  Ansible是对机群进行软体安装、设定和应用部署的自动化工具。自2012年Ansible出现后,以其使用简单、功能实用等特点获得了广泛关注,成为自动化运行维护工具中的冉冉新星。仅三年后就被红帽(Red Hat)公司收购,目前受到许多软体公司的关注、推广和使用。自动化部署无论对系统管理员还是对软体开发人员来说,都会减少重复的手动操作,加强部署效率。Ansible作为学习成本小、学习路径短的一款工具,更是值得了解和使用。

  作为一本Ansible入门书籍,读者只需对Linux有最基本的了解就可以轻松读懂本书。

  本书的内容共计6章,分为以下三个部分:

  ■ 第一部分 Ansible基本工具的说明(第1章∼第4章)
  本书首先介绍了Ansible架构,然后说明了Ansible的主要概念,接着又介绍了一些实际使用方法,步步递进、层层深入地介绍了Ansible的相关知识。
  第4章对前面3章中的知识细节进行了补充,以便读者能够深入了解Ansible的基本使用方法。

  ■ 第二部分 role和衍生工具Ansible Galaxy的介绍(第5章)
  role是Ansible最为推荐的重用程式的方式,并为其开发了Ansible Galaxy程式分享网站。但因其概念较为复杂,所以对其单独说明。

  ■ 第三部分 企业级收费软体Ansible Tower介绍(第6章)
  企业级使用者面临着更加复杂的应用环境和更高的安全要求,Ansible Tower就是一款解决企业级使用者难题的收费软体。

  ✤ 程式的执行环境

  建议读者安装Linux虚拟机器作为Ansible的管理节点来测试本书中的程式。Ansible目前已被红帽公司收购,对Red Hat Linux系统的支援较为增强,建议读者最好选择Red Hat Linux 7或CentOS 7。
 

图书试读

用户评价

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 ttbooks.qciss.net All Rights Reserved. 小特书站 版权所有